This murder mystery soon evolves into a battle of wits between Battler, another grandchild, and the being calling herself Beatrice, with Battler desperate to prove that the crimes occurred without supernatural intervention as the sequence of arrivals and murders is repeated via a cyclic timeline. The survivors are left to frantically try to determine whether there is indeed a "Beatrice" or whether one among them was the culprit, a task made more difficult by the apparently physically impossible circumstances of some of the murders. The youngest grandchild, Maria, brings a mysterious letter from a "Beatrice" to the dinner table, leading some to speculate that an additional person is hiding somewhere on the island that night, a series of gruesome murders occur. Kinzo refuses to see his family upon their arrival, and soon, a storm strands everybody on the island and leaves them without phone service. The members of the wealthy Ushiromiya family arrive on their private island of Rokkenjima to discuss what should be done with the inheritance of their terminally ill patriarch, Kinzo. In May 2018, there was released the updated 4.4 Android version of Mobirise. On June 16, 2017, version 4.0 was released, which presented the new core engine, new interface and new default website theme. Since version 3.0, added some new themes and extension and introduced support for Bootstrap 4. On September 30, 2015, version 2.0 was released, which added drop-down menus, contact forms, animations, support for 3rd-party themes and extensions. On the first beta version 1.0 was released with the focus on no-coding web design and compliance to the Google mobile-friendly update. It is headquartered in Eindhoven, Netherlands. Mobirise is essentially a drag and drop website builder, featuring various website themes. Mobirise is a freeware web design application that allows users to design and publish bootstrap websites without coding. Being in the short weapons family, the hook sword can be seen to share about 70-80% of its basic techniques and strategies with other sword/saber methods, with the remainder arising from the unique qualities of its construction. The Crescent Moon guard over the grip would be used for blocking, trapping, and striking. Its methods are a combination of techniques of sword/saber (the long, straight sharpened section), cane or hook (the hooked section, which was also sharp), and dagger (which extends down past the handle. Calipers function similarly to a clamp and will help stop the wheel from rotating when you apply the brakes. When you apply the brakes, calipers will help slow the vehicle by pressing one or more pistons against the brake pads, which in turn press against the rotors, causing friction. What Is Brake Caliper Replacement?īrake calipers house your vehicle’s brake pads. You will also need to bleed the brakes to replace the calipers.
